Watched Indiana vs. Michigan, first Big Ten game of the year for Michigan. Was just the first game that came up when I went to look, figured it was early enough in the season that the team hadn't quit on the coach yet. I didn't check his stats beforehand to go in fresh.

-Reed played solid D on Kel'el Ware early in the game, but Ware made like 3 really tough shots over him (makes me appreciate Clingan even more).
-Reed traveled twice and then didn't catch an easy roll pass in the first 15 minutes or so. Those were the main times he was passed the ball in the half court in first half.
Michigan-Indiana-Reed-can-t-catch.gif

-He had an offensive rebound putback that it seemed like he just threw up that went in.
-He had a great stretch where he deflected 2 entry passes and then shortly after stripped a driver and then leaked out for an alley oop dunk.
Michigan-Indiana-Reed-double-deflection.gif

-He got benched down the stretch in favor of Tschetter, but then coach put him back in for offense/defense (the defense part) in the last minute. In a 1-point game with under 10 seconds to go, he knocked the ball out of bounds on a rebound that pretty much sealed the loss.

So maybe I caught one of his bad ones. Gonna watch a later in the season game vs. Wisconsin that looks like Michigan won.

Reed and Michigan vs. Wisconsin later in the year. (No idea what's going on with gifs, they load fine for me in the text before posting).

-Opening possession, late contesting a switch on an OOB play.
-Forces a travel in 1v1 post D.
-Steal and dunk on terrible Wisconsin pass.
-Incredibly lazy PnR defense just waving at the ball instead of moving his feet. Roll guy can't catch a simple pass and it falls to Reed, credited with one of the least deserved steals I've seen.
- Blocks a shot in 1v1 post D.
-Directing guys around on offense positioning is a good sign for his BBIQ.
-Stunts at a guy on the perimeter, ball is passed to his man and he's a bit out of position due to the help and gets driven by and scored on.
-Clogging the lane a bit (not great spatial positioning), but gets a dump off pass for a dunk anyways because Wisconsin D is bad. A very involved first 4 minutes start to the game for him.
-Dribbles out of a double team, then attacks his man again, drives at him and draws a foul. Pretty agile and a load. Bricks first FT, makes 2nd.
-Disciplined post D as guy drives in towards the basket, doesn't really go for any fakes, the guy kicks out.
-Forces a jump ball, absolutely horrid call they call him for a reach in foul.
-They miss him open on a roll, but he settles into good post position. They get him the ball, he draws a double once again dribbles out of it and then attacks off the dribble and draws a foul.
Michigan-Wisconsin-Reed-dribble-out-of-double-and-then-attacks.gif

-Reach in foul on a drive. Seemed a bit tired, long shift.
-Offensive rebound activity leads to jump ball.
-To start 2nd half, they get him the ball at the top of the arc and he finds a cutter. First time I've seen the passing people have talked about. Looked a lot like a Clingan DHO read.
-Few minutes later, passes out of the post for an open double team (both clips below).
Michigan-Wisconsin-Reed-passing.gif

-Running jump hook, not especially close.
-The best highlight from his highlight reel, the catch, face, stutter step, drive by the guy and jam.
-Pick and roll alley-oop draws a foul.
-Weakside block on drive help.
-Poor box out leads to ball oob off him.
-Travels on a post up.
-Good screen frees shooter, Reed oreb. They reach in on him. He misses both FTs.
-Reed blocks a shot, quick 2nd jump.

Overall impressions:
  • More involved in February for the team vs. December.
  • Agile for his size. Long. Body type and movement reminds me of Eric Dixon plus a few inches of height. He's not "below the rim" but not vertically explosive either.
  • Very good 1v1 post defender. Hard to move, mostly stays down. Physical without fouling. Closes space when offensive player goes to make a move. Same way we teach it.
  • Decent weakside rim protector, but not a guy who is shutting off the paint to the opposition.
  • Can post up or face up, but travels too often when posted up.
  • Flashes of passing, but mostly flashes at this point.
  • Hands are still a question mark at times for an elite prospect. Gets a lot of fingertips on balls without securing on rebounds/blocks.
  • Has a plan against double teams. Decent BBIQ and good communicator on the court.
